Start line:  
End line:  

Snippet Preview

Snippet HTML Code

Stack Overflow Questions
 package bpiwowar.experiments;
 
 
@TaskDescription(name = "run", project = { "main" })
public class RunClass implements Task {
	final static private Logger logger = Logger.getLogger();
	private String[] args;
	private Method method;

		.invoke(nullnew Object[] {  });
		return 0;
	}
	public void init(String[] argsthrows Exception {
		if (args.length == 0)
			throw new ArgParseException(
					"Expected at least one argument (the class name)");
		final String className = args[0];
		this. = Arrays.copyOfRange(args, 1, args.length);
		.info("Loading class %s"className);
		Class<?> loadClass = getClass().getClassLoader().loadClass(className);
		 = loadClass.getMethod("main"String[].class);
	}
New to GrepCode? Check out our FAQ X